293. The Monster that Challenged the World (1957) 12.10.2024

In which X7 takes a look at a rather underrated monster movie from 1957- The Monster that Challenged the World ! A small army of molluscs declare war on the Salton Sea , eating several of the human inhabitants. Our heroes have to figure out what they are and stop them, or they may indeed challenge the entire world! A nice write up here !

290. Red Robot of the Stars! 10.10.2024

In which X7 reviews the Taiwanese movie Iron Superman , which used footage from the 1974 Japanese show Super Robot Mach Baron . Anyone saying Power Rangers invented this sort of movie-making needs to review the history of such things. It is rather difficult to find out much information about either the movie or the series, but it is a good way to get an English subtitled look at it. Robot Punch!

280. Gamera vs. Monster X part 1 29.09.2024

In which X7 talks about the sixth Gamera movie, Gamera vs. Monster X ! This 1970 movie has no stock footage from previous movies in it and is really well done. Gamera meets the first female monster in the series and may have met his match! You will have to watch part two to find out what happens!
